What are the signs a 2014 Volkswagen Touareg needs transmission service?
Key signs include delayed or harsh engagement, slipping under load, shudder at light throttle, whining or humming that changes with gear, burnt‑smelling or dark fluid, and a transmission warning or stored fault code.
Any of these symptoms on a 2014 Volkswagen Touareg warrant prompt diagnosis to prevent accelerated wear. In the Phoenix West Valley’s heat and traffic, fluid can degrade faster, so don’t ignore changes in shift quality. Our Avondale team will scan for codes, inspect fluid condition, and road‑test to pinpoint the cause before recommending service.
- Delayed Drive/Reverse engagement or hard upshifts/downshifts
- Shudder on light acceleration or steady‑speed cruising
- Warning light or stored transmission fault code
Can I keep driving a 2014 Volkswagen Touareg that’s slipping or shifting hard?
No—continued driving with slipping or harsh shifts can turn a correctable fluid/filtration issue into internal damage that may require major repair.
If your 2014 Volkswagen Touareg feels like it’s flaring between gears, bangs into gear, or won’t hold a gear under load, reduce driving and schedule diagnosis. Heat is the primary killer of automatic transmissions, and our Avondale climate can amplify damage when the unit is already struggling. We’ll verify fluid condition, check for codes, and advise the safest next step.
- Limit driving to prevent heat‑related wear
- Schedule a diagnostic road test and scan at our Avondale shop
- Address concerns early to protect clutches and valve body
Drain-and-fill or full fluid exchange — which does a 2014 Volkswagen Touareg need?
A drain‑and‑fill replaces only the fluid in the pan, while a full exchange replaces most of the transmission’s total fluid volume; the right choice depends on service history and current fluid condition after inspection.
We examine the 2014 Volkswagen Touareg’s fluid color/odor, check for debris, and review maintenance records before recommending a service type. In some cases, a staged approach is appropriate; in others, a more complete exchange provides a better reset. We always follow Volkswagen procedures and confirm final fluid level at the proper temperature.
- Drain‑and‑fill: lower cost, partial refresh
- Exchange: closer to full fluid volume replacement
- Decision based on inspection, not defaulting to the pricier option

What’s included in a 2014 Volkswagen Touareg transmission service?
A proper service includes a fluid level/condition check, electronic scan for transmission codes, the selected drain‑and‑fill or exchange, correct re‑seal where applicable, fluid level set at the specified temperature, and a road test.
On a 2014 Volkswagen Touareg, we begin by inspecting for leaks and capturing any stored faults that affect shift quality. After service, we validate operation on a road test covering light and moderate throttle and verify no new codes are set. You’ll receive findings and recommendations based on what we see.
- Inspection for leaks, wear debris, and fault codes
- Service type performed as inspected/approved
- Final level set to spec and documented road test
Do symptoms on a 2014 Volkswagen Touareg always mean it just needs fluid?
No—slip, shudder, or harsh shifts can indicate mechanical wear or control issues, so diagnosis comes first before any fluid service.
Fluid condition matters, but the 2014 Volkswagen Touareg can also show symptoms from solenoid, valve body, mechatronic, or software faults. Our Avondale team uses scan‑tool data and a road test to separate fluid‑related concerns from mechanical ones. We only recommend service that aligns with findings.
- Scan data and adaptives reviewed before service
- Mechanical vs. fluid‑related causes differentiated
- Clear next steps based on evidence
